I love in-home newborn sessions. It makes everything so much easier for new parents. When we do an in-home newborn session as opposed to a studio newborn photography session, parents have everything they could need or want at their fingertips. And when you’re just getting to know a newborn, having everything you need within reach is so important!

I always give parents two options: a session with a backdrop and props, or a more natural session in their home using their existing furniture like a sofa, their bed, or baby’s nursery. For Aiden’s newborn session, we went the backdrop route and it couldn’t have gone better! I got to use my new wraps and favorite basket along with a few of Aiden’s toys as props. For the background, I set up my whitewash brick backdrop and fake wood floor from Denny’s Manufacturing. And in order to get the best light for the session, I squeezed the backdrop in by the kitchen. It’s a good thing I only needed a 6×6 foot space!

Since Baby Aiden was born just before Halloween, we just had to incorporate the cute pumpkin hat that mom found on Etsy! And this little boy was all about cuddles from mom – which is completely normal! With that said, one of the reasons I give over 2 hours for a session is because you just never know how newborns are going to feel on any given day. It took all of that and a little more to get him away from mom long enough for his portrait. But, in the end, the patience was totally worth it. After 2+ hours of cuddles, diaper changes, and feedings, we were able to get great photos – truly some of my favorites. We finished with Aiden in dad’s arm. He was clearly happy there, and he gave us all a little smile as he held onto mom’s finger – the perfect ending.
